Output 41f89873495ec7bbf2edf73d729fd4b926c0569bf33a79ef077cbbf93ba784b3:5

value
29326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2854fdd498e6ad0f6cc8c2f3b12c0bf913ba2ef OP_EQUAL
address
3GWM6JFxPqBzHeJxdNtAyW731qarEAHXQa
transaction
41f89873495ec7bbf2edf73d729fd4b926c0569bf33a79ef077cbbf93ba784b3
confirmations
241353
spent
true